**Reason 1: Boost Your Home's Curb Appeal**

When it comes to selling your home in Lakeland, the first impression is everything. A beautifully designed landscape can increase your property value by up to 10% and make it more attractive to potential buyers. Professional landscaping design takes into account the unique characteristics of your property, including its size, shape, and topography. Our team will work with you to create a customized design that complements your home's architecture and enhances its curb appeal.

**Factors to Consider for Curb Appeal**

* Plant selection: Choose plants that thrive in Lakeland's subtropical climate (USDA Hardiness Zone 9b) * Color scheme: Select a palette that complements your home's exterior colors * Texture and pattern: Mix different textures and patterns to add depth and visual interest

**Reason 2: Protect Your Investment with Water-Saving Solutions**

Lakeland's hot and humid climate means that water conservation is crucial, especially during the wet season (June-September). A professional landscaping design takes into account the unique challenges of Lakeland's weather, including heavy rainfall and high humidity. Our team will work with you to implement water-saving solutions, such as drought-tolerant plants, rain barrels, and smart irrigation systems.

**Water-Saving Tips for Lakeland Homeowners**

* Choose plants that require minimal watering (e.g., succulents, cacti) * Install a rain barrel or cistern to collect and store rainwater * Use a smart irrigation controller to optimize water usage

**Frequently Asked Questions**

Q: How much does professional landscaping design cost in Lakeland? A: The cost of professional landscaping design varies depending on the scope of work, materials used, and location. On average, homeowners can expect to pay between $2,000 and $10,000 for a comprehensive design.

Q: What are some common mistakes homeowners make when designing their own landscapes? A: Common mistakes include selecting plants that don't thrive in Lakeland's climate, neglecting to consider drainage and irrigation systems, and ignoring the importance of hardscaping features like patios and walkways.
